Nuclear war has finally destroyed what little was left of civilization. Bartertown is a city on the edge of a desert that has managed to retain some technology. After being exiled from the town, a drifter travels with a group of abandoned children to rebel against its queen.

Views: 71

Quality: HD

Release: 1985

IMDb: 6.2